Nestled in the heart of Stockholm, Royal Djurgården is a picturesque national park that seamlessly blends nature, culture, and history. This lush green oasis is not just a park; it's a vibrant hub for tourists looking to immerse themselves in the beauty of the Swedish countryside without leaving the city. Spanning over 200 hectares, Djurgården is home to a variety of walking paths, cycling routes, and tranquil waterfronts, making it an ideal spot for leisurely strolls or more active pursuits. The park is dotted with historic buildings and museums, including the renowned Vasa Museum, where visitors can marvel at a beautifully preserved 17th-century warship, and the Skansen open-air museum, showcasing Swedish history and culture through traditional architecture and live demonstrations. In addition to its rich cultural offerings, Djurgården is surrounded by lush vegetation and offers numerous picnic spots where families can relax and enjoy the serene atmosphere. The park is also popular for its wildlife; keep an eye out for the diverse bird species that inhabit the area. Whether you choose to rent a bike, enjoy a boat tour along the waterways, or simply take a moment to soak in the stunning views of the surrounding landscape, Royal Djurgården promises a memorable experience for every visitor. Local tips
- Visit early in the morning or late afternoon for fewer crowds and a more peaceful experience.
- Consider renting a bike to explore the extensive pathways more efficiently.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y in one of the many scenic spots within the park.
- Don’t miss the seasonal events and exhibitions often held in the park and its museums.
- Check the weather before your visit to dress appropriately for outdoor activities.

Getting There
-
Public Transport
If you are in central Stockholm, start by heading to T-Centralen, the main subway station. From T-Centralen, take the T14 line towards 'Kungsträdgården' and get off at 'Kungsträdgården' station. Once you exit the station, walk towards the waterfront and follow the path leading to the Djurgården ferry terminal. Take the ferry (Djurgårdsfärjan) to Djurgården. The ferry ride offers beautiful views of the city and takes about 10 minutes. Once you arrive at Djurgården, follow the signs leading to Royal Djurgården, which is a short walk from the ferry terminal.
-
Walking
If you are staying in the Östermalm area, you can walk to Royal Djurgården. Start from the southern end of Strandvägen and walk towards the Djurgården Bridge. As you cross the bridge, you will see the entrance to Djurgården on your right. Follow the paths leading into the park, and you will find the various attractions within Royal Djurgården, including the beautiful gardens and museums.
-
Bus
From central Stockholm, you can take bus number 69 from 'T-Centralen' or any nearby stop. The bus will take you directly to 'Djurgården', where you can disembark at the 'Djurgårdsbron' stop. After getting off, follow the signs towards Royal Djurgården, which is a short walk from the bus stop.
